Find the mass in grams of a carbon dioxide molecule.
1 answer
12 + 15.994 914 6221 + 15.994 914 6221 = 43,998 amu =7.3•10^(-26) kg =
=7.3•10^(-23) g
1 amu ≈ 1,660 ∙10^(−27) kg
